Indian Wedding at Venue TwentyTwo - The Westin: Aly & Nisara

When it comes to Indian weddings, the fusion of culture, tradition, and elegance is truly unmatched. Aly and Nisara’s wedding at Venue TwentyTwo, the luxurious rooftop venue at The Westin Hotel in Downtown Ottawa, was a breathtaking reflection of all these elements. Surrounded by the vibrant cityscape and the serenity of the Ottawa skyline, their celebration was a beautiful blend of age-old customs and modern sophistication.

The day began with the couple embracing the heart of Indian tradition in their wedding attire. Aly, looking every bit the handsome groom, wore a classic grey suit, while Nisara looked radiant in her bridal saree, a stunning ensemble in rich hues of cream and white, symbolizing love, passion, and prosperity. The wedding ceremony took place in a traditional setting, with intricate rituals that brought both families together, honoring not just the union of the couple, but the merging of two cultures and families.

The air was filled with the scent of marigold flowers and incense as the couple exchanged vows in front of close family and friends. The ceremony itself was an emotional and spiritual experience, with Aly and Nisara participating in the sacred "pheras" (seven vows) around the holy fire, an ancient ritual that signifies their commitment to one another. It was a moment of deep reflection for both, as they promised to support and cherish each other through every phase of life.
